Genoa National Fish Hatchery Featured on Coulee Region Outdoor Show
Midwest Region, January 31, 2007

The Genoa National Fish Hatchery was featured on the Coulee Region's premiere outdoor radio talk show.  Bob Lamb, and Jerry Davis, two area sportsmen and outdoor writers featured the station on their hourly program. 

The show offers listerners a great opportunity to learn about current programs and upcoming events.  

Hot issues discussed were the latest interstate fish transfer restrictions due to the VHS outbreak in the Great Lakes, and how the impacts of these restrictions were going to affect hatchery operations.  The station will be working closely with the LaCrosse Fish Health Center and others to ensure that important programs such as Endangered mussel recovery and spring egg collections on the Mississippi River can continue. 

The hatchery's upcoming 75th anniversary was also promoted.  The event will be held on August 8th, and will include many of our River partners such as the Upper Mississippi River National Wildlife and Fish Refuge, the Corps of Engineers, our Friends group, and literally a cast of 100's.   

The purpose of Friends of the Upper Mississippi River Fisheries Services was then discussed.  The group is dedicated to maintaining and promoting the health of the Upper Mississippi River's fisheries and aquatic resource populations, and supporting the mission of the three LaCrosse area Fish and Wildlife Fisheries stations, the LaCrosse Fish Health Center, the LaCrosse Fisheries Resource Office, and the Genoa National Fish Hatchery.  Listeners were invited to get involved, and become part of a dedicated group of individuals working to promote good stewardship of our Region's fish and wildlife resources.
